Click noise when starting or pausing videos with DTS or AC3 audio
#1
Hi
I have a Philips HTS3111 soundbar that is connected to my HTPC (Windows 7 64bit) over an optical cable. Videos that have a DTS or an AC3 audio track start with a loud click noise but play fine after that. When I pause the video it pauses with the same click noise. The lights on the soundbar flicker when I start or pause a video but indicate the correct audio format (AC3 or DTS) after that.

I tried to disable the settings "DTS capable receiver" and "Dolby Digital (AC3) capable receiver" which solves my issues i.e. no click noise but I don't have DTS or AC3 sound obviously.

I can partially solve the issues i.e. no click noise when I output the sound over hdmi and connect my soundbar directly to the TV over a coaxial cable. But my TV doesn't support DTS and only passes AC3 through.

I'm using Eden Beta 1 but have the same issues with Dharma.

Any suggestions?

#9
With my old Onkyo receiver I had the clicking issue with the digital audio passthru. I got a new Onkyo receiver recently and the annoyance stopped. This happened with Dharma. Since I don't have the old receiver anymore I cannot test with Eden. I believe the problem is NOT with XBMC but rather that some audio hardware does not switch over from analog to digital quickly enough and therefore a click noise is heard.
